Before the incident
Helping a guest remove an alligator from their fishing line.
What happened
The alligator fell off the fishing line and swung back embedding the hook into employee 's cheek
Injury or illness
Puncture wound
Object or substance involved
Fishing hook
Summary line
Puncture to cheek
